Football Recap: Mountainside Wolves vs. San Carlos Braves

Mountainside won the last time they faced San Carlos, and things went their way on Friday too. The Mountainside Wolves came out on top against the San Carlos Braves by a score of 25-14. The win made it back-to-back victories for the Wolves.

Mountainside was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 207 rushing yards.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as San Carlos only rushed for 94.

Although San Carlos took the loss, they still got scores from Jayson Kenton and Anson Kinney.

Mountainside's victory ended a three-game drought on the road dating back to last season and puts them at 2-0. As for San Carlos, their loss dropped their record down to 1-1.

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Mountainside will head out to face off against St. John Paul II Catholic at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for San Carlos, they will venture away from home to square off against Tombstone at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
